摘 要:A flexible anode composite,carbon cloth@SiO_(2)composite(CC@SiO_(2)),was synthesized by a one-step solution method using tetraethyl orthosilicate(TEOS)as the silica ***@SiO_(2)can be directly used as the negative electrode material for lithium-ion battery,and its initial reversible deintercalation capacity reaches 1358.7 mA·h·g^(-1).The electrode shows a capacity of 863.8 mA·h·g^(-1)up to 130 cycles at 0.5 A·g^(-1),displaying excellent rate performance and cycle stability.
